Shield

18th century to 19th century (made)
Artist/Maker
Place of origin

Shield dhal convex, of lacquered buffalo hide with raised decoration in the form of carnation motifs linked by curving tendrils; in the centre is an open flower surrounded by a border of foliage ornament; this is repeated round the edge of the shield which is recurved sharply round the rim; near the centre are four dome shaped iron bosses with fretted fleurette borders and decorated with a gold damascened pattern of plants and leaves; these are attached at the back to four iron holding rings set at the corner of a turquoise velvet rectangle bound with red silk and silver gilt braid; the holding straps are covered with similar turquoise velvet and are attached to the rings. The hide is scuffed and holed in places.
